Keeping your chin up is the secret to a long life, according to a Mitcham woman who has just reached a grand old age.
Ida Johnson celebrated her 95th birthday with a surprise party at the Taylor Road Day Centre last Friday.
Ms Johnson said the key to her long life was a healthy diet, moderate exercise and positive mental attitude.
She is a member of the Positive Network Group, a social club which meets at the centre.
The group’s director, Grace Salmon, said: “It is a real pleasure to work with Ida.
"We call her Mother Ida, because she is a real inspiration to us all.
"She talks to the group on being positive and taking life at a slow pace.”
